I know neither Yakima Racks nor Thule Racks make a 1997 Ford Crown Victoria roof rack that will mount on non-permanently as they do for most other car models. What you cna do though is permanently install a car rack on top by using a set of four Yakima #7 Landing Pads. These are made to permanently install onto vehicles with metal roofs. Once the #7 Landing Pads are in place you then connect a set of four Yakima Control Towers to the Landing Pads. Then all you do is attach a pair of yakima cross bars (get the 58 inch length bars for the Ford Crown Victoria) to the Control Towers and you have a very solid base rack foundation that you can then connect any of yakima racks gear carriers to the pair of cross bars.
